Prince’s Nothing Compares 2 U
Most of us know this song via Sinéad O’Connor’s version, but the Prince Estate just released this recording from 1984, with footage from rehearsals with the Revolution.

Day of the Dead
4AD released this week the Grateful Dead tribute compilation Day of the Dead – it’s the 20th album in the Red Hot series to help raise money and awareness about HIV/Aids. Stream it below. https://open.spotify.com/album/19aZxgHJEtveuVPhDFTMMG

KCRW VR App
The fine folks at KCRW have introduced a VR app, which you can use with viewers like Cardboard and your Android or iOS phone, to view performances from the KCRW studios.
